- 1.The concentration of a pollutant in a lake, in arbitrary units, follows the recurrence C_{n+1} = 0.75C_n + 40, with C_0 = 500: each week, 25% of the pollutant breaks down naturally, and then a further 40 units enter the lake from run-off. An ecologist classifies the lake as safe once C_n first drops below 300. Find the first whole number of weeks after which the lake is safe.
- 2.The height of a ball, in metres, above the ground is plotted against time, in seconds, after it is thrown. The tangent to the graph at t = 1.5 seconds has gradient 2. Which of these four statements about the ball at t = 1.5 seconds is correct?
- 3.A crate exerts a force of 84 N on the floor through a base with an area of 2.4 m². Work out the pressure on the floor, in N/m².
- 4.Simplify the ratio 45 : 30 : 75 to its simplest form.
- 5.The number of subscribers to a streaming app, in thousands, is plotted against time, in months since launch. A tangent to the graph at t = 6 months has gradient 4.8. A tangent at t = 18 months has gradient 1.1. A manager claims the app is growing faster at 18 months than it was at 6 months. Work out how the growth rate has changed, and decide whether the manager is correct.
- 6.A journey takes 4 hours at an average speed of 60 km/h. The time taken is inversely proportional to the average speed. Work out how long the same journey takes at an average speed of 80 km/h.
- 7.A curve has equation y = 2x² + 5. Work out an estimate for the gradient of the curve at x = 3, using a chord between the points where x = 2 and x = 4.y = 2x² + 5
- 8.Two mathematically similar jugs have heights 8 cm and 12 cm. The smaller jug holds 200 ml when it is full. Work out how much the larger jug holds when it is full.
- 9.A shop's takings were £4500 in May. In June the takings fell by £900. Write the June takings as a fraction of the May takings, in its simplest form.
- 10.A population of fish in a lake is modelled by the recurrence P_{n+1} = 1.1P_n − 30, where P_n is the population after n years, 30 fish are removed by fishing each year, and P_0 = 400. After how many complete years does the population first exceed 460?
- 11.A force of 250 N acts on an area of 0.5 m². Using pressure = force ÷ area, work out the pressure, in pascals.
- 12.Two investors put money into a business in the ratio 3:5. The first investor puts in £1,200. Work out the total amount invested by both investors.
- 13.A salt solution has a concentration of 10%. The solution contains 50 g of salt. Work out the total mass of the solution.
- 14.The value of a delivery van, in £, is plotted against its age, in years, since it was bought. At age 2 years, the gradient of the tangent to the graph is −950. What does this tell you about the van at age 2 years?
- 15.A recipe for pastry uses flour and butter in the ratio 3:2. A baker has 180 g of butter and wants to make pastry using all of it. Work out the total mass of pastry the baker can make.
